Mauricio Pochettino's Chelsea need a “miracle” to save their season now

“Chelsea’s recruitment staff have got this wrong,” Steve Nicol said.

Former Liverpool player Steve Nicol talked about Chelsea’s poor start to the Premier League. He doesn’t hold back when it comes to laying into Blues.

Nicol claimed the team needed a “miracle” to save their season now. He pointed out finger at the recruitment team who had put this group together.

Chelsea had a poor season last term as well when they missed out on qualification from UEFA competitions. They sacked two managers in the same season.

“Chelsea’s recruitment staff have got this wrong. The coach, regardless of who it is, is finding it hard to put the pieces of this puzzle together. If he’s given pieces of the puzzle that don’t fit, you’re looking for a miracle. They need a miracle,” Nicol admitted.

Chelsea’s season has been tough so far with just one win in Premier League. They lost to Aston Villa 1-0 recently and it was their 3rd loss in the top-flight. They now moved to 14th in the table.
